Ticket #4412 — Plugins losing DB connections during ORM refactor

Hey plugin authors — while we rip out the old Quillora ORM layer, the legacy pool settings keep dropping idle connections after ~30s. If your plugin talks to storage directly, switch to the new adapter and bump your timeout. Until the refactor lands, test against the interim sandbox database, reachable with the connection string below.

replica DSN, kajep-yahag: mssql://praok_svc:iF@db-8d68.plorvaio.local:5432/eliion

## Prop Transport — Moonveil Tour

All stage props for the Moonveil tour move in flight cases only. Crate 4 holds the glass lantern set; keep upright, no stacking. Load order per the dock sheet, heaviest first. Courier from Bramford Freight arrives Thursday, 07:30 bay 2. Check case seals before release. The hand-over instruction below is confidential and must be followed exactly as written.

drop instructions, yafog-yawip: the quenmir olidor courier leaves the julox tamion keliel ledger at gate 5283 under passcode 336825

### Catalog Cache Invalidation (Ostermere)

Quick rundown: the Ostermere catalog cache invalidates via versioned keys, so stale reads are bounded rather than eliminated. From a security angle, the thing to check is that price updates can't be pinned by a replayed purge message — purges are signed and expire fast. TTLs are deliberately short on price fields, longer on descriptions. The current windows and limits are set as follows.

limits module of yadug-tawip:
QUOTAS = {
    "julael": 705,
    "kasael": 903,
    "druwyn": 489,
}